Brendan Coughlin, Head of Consumer Banking at Citizens Financial Group, reports acquisition and disposal of company stock on March 1, 2024.

Summary

  • On March 1, 2024, Brendan Coughlin, Head of Consumer Banking at Citizens Financial Group, reported changes in beneficial ownership of the company's stock.
  • Coughlin acquired 28,256 shares of common stock at $0.00 per share.
  • He also disposed of 14,627 shares at $31.39 per share.
  • Following these transactions, Coughlin directly owns 118,390.351 shares of Citizens Financial Group stock.

Industry Context

Form 4 filings are a routine part of corporate governance, providing transparency into the transactions of company insiders and their holdings in the company's stock. These filings are monitored by investors to gain insights into management's perspective on the company's value and future prospects.
